-/**
- * Hotplug detect deferred task
- *
- * Called after level change on hpd GPIO to evaluate (and debounce) what event
- * has occurred. There are 3 events that occur on HPD:
- * 1. low : downstream display sink is deattached
- * 2. high : downstream display sink is attached
- * 3. irq : downstream display sink signalling an interrupt.
- *
- * The debounce times for these various events are:
- * HPD_USTREAM_DEBOUNCE_LVL : min pulse width of level value.
- * HPD_USTREAM_DEBOUNCE_IRQ : min pulse width of IRQ low pulse.
- *
- * lvl(n-2) lvl(n-1) lvl prev_delta now_delta event
- * ----------------------------------------------------
- * 1 0 1 <IRQ n/a low glitch (ignore)
- * 1 0 1 >IRQ <LVL irq
- * x 0 1 n/a >LVL high
- * 0 1 0 <LVL n/a high glitch (ignore)
- * x 1 0 n/a >LVL low
- */
-
-void hpd_irq_deferred(void)
-{
- pd_send_hpd(0, hpd_irq);
-}
-DECLARE_DEFERRED(hpd_irq_deferred);
-
-void hpd_lvl_deferred(void)
-{
- int level = gpio_get_level(GPIO_DP_HPD);
-
- if (level != hpd_prev_level)
- /* It's a glitch while in deferred or canceled action */
- return;
-
- pd_send_hpd(0, (level) ? hpd_high : hpd_low);
-}
-DECLARE_DEFERRED(hpd_lvl_deferred);
-
-void hpd_event(enum gpio_signal signal)
-{
- timestamp_t now = get_time();
- int level = gpio_get_level(signal);
- uint64_t cur_delta = now.val - hpd_prev_ts;
-
- /* store current time */
- hpd_prev_ts = now.val;
-
- /* All previous hpd level events need to be re-triggered */
- hook_call_deferred(&hpd_lvl_deferred_data, -1);
-
- /* It's a glitch. Previous time moves but level is the same. */
- if (cur_delta < HPD_USTREAM_DEBOUNCE_IRQ)
- return;
-
- if ((!hpd_prev_level && level) &&
- (cur_delta < HPD_USTREAM_DEBOUNCE_LVL))
- /* It's an irq */
- hook_call_deferred(&hpd_irq_deferred_data, 0);
- else if (cur_delta >= HPD_USTREAM_DEBOUNCE_LVL)
- hook_call_deferred(&hpd_lvl_deferred_data,
- HPD_USTREAM_DEBOUNCE_LVL);
-
- hpd_prev_level = level;
-}

-/**
- * USB configuration
- * Any type-C device with alternate mode capabilities must have the following
- * set of descriptors.
- *
- * 1. Standard Device
- * 2. BOS
- * 2a. Container ID
- * 2b. Billboard Caps
- */
-struct my_bos {
- struct usb_bos_hdr_descriptor bos;
- struct usb_contid_caps_descriptor contid_caps;
- struct usb_bb_caps_base_descriptor bb_caps;
- struct usb_bb_caps_svid_descriptor bb_caps_svids[1];
-};
-
-static struct my_bos bos_desc = {
- .bos = {
- .bLength = USB_DT_BOS_SIZE,
- .bDescriptorType = USB_DT_BOS,
- .wTotalLength = (USB_DT_BOS_SIZE + USB_DT_CONTID_SIZE +
- USB_BB_CAPS_BASE_SIZE +
- USB_BB_CAPS_SVID_SIZE * 1),
- .bNumDeviceCaps = 2, /* contid + bb_caps */
- },
- .contid_caps = {
- .bLength = USB_DT_CONTID_SIZE,
- .bDescriptorType = USB_DT_DEVICE_CAPABILITY,
- .bDevCapabilityType = USB_DC_DTYPE_CONTID,
- .bReserved = 0,
- .ContainerID = {0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0},
- },
- .bb_caps = {
- .bLength = (USB_BB_CAPS_BASE_SIZE + USB_BB_CAPS_SVID_SIZE * 1),
- .bDescriptorType = USB_DT_DEVICE_CAPABILITY,
- .bDevCapabilityType = USB_DC_DTYPE_BILLBOARD,
- .iAdditionalInfoURL = USB_STR_BB_URL,
- .bNumberOfAlternateModes = 1,
- .bPreferredAlternateMode = 1,
- .VconnPower = 0,
- .bmConfigured = {0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0,
- 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0},
- .bReserved = 0,
- },
- .bb_caps_svids = {
- {
- .wSVID = USB_SID_DISPLAYPORT,
- .bAlternateMode = 1,
- .iAlternateModeString = USB_STR_BB_URL, /* TODO(crosbug.com/p/32687) */
- },
- },
-};
-
-const struct bos_context bos_ctx = {
- .descp = (void *)&bos_desc,
- .size = sizeof(struct my_bos),
-};
